First, get the fit right

Our hoodies are cut relaxed with a slightly dropped shoulder. If you want a clean, tailored look, take your true size. If you want the oversized silhouette you see in our editorials, size up once — no more. Two sizes up loses the shoulder line and the print sits too low on the chest.

The three-second rule for prints

Whatever you layer on top should never cut a printed line in half. Open jackets, cropped shackets and unbuttoned shirts frame the print. A closed blazer hides it. Simple as that.

1. The clean errand fit

Cream hoodie, straight-leg mid-blue denim, white leather sneakers, navy cap. This is the baseline. Keep the denim a shade darker than the hoodie so the print stays the brightest thing in the outfit. Cuff the hem once to show the shoe.

2. Monochrome and quiet

Cream hoodie with sand or oatmeal wide-leg trousers and tan loafers. Tonal dressing makes a printed hoodie read as intentional rather than casual. Add one gold detail — a thin chain, small hoops — to echo the gold in our hangtag palette.

3. Under a coat, for real weather

Hoodie under a long navy or camel wool coat, with black straight trousers and boots. Leave the coat open so the print shows in the gap. Pull the hood out over the collar; that small piece of texture is what stops the look from feeling stiff.

4. Dressed up with tailoring

Hoodie, sharp black wide-leg trousers, pointed flats or heeled boots. The contrast between the soft fleece and a crisp trouser line is the whole outfit. This works for dinner, a gallery, a low-key event — anywhere you want to be comfortable and still look composed.

5. Layered over a collar

A white or striped shirt under the hoodie, collar and cuffs showing. It adds structure at the neck and instantly makes the hoodie look styled. Keep the shirt crisp cotton; anything oversized bunches under the fleece.

6. Weekend, unbothered

Hoodie with matching lounge joggers, chunky socks and a canvas tote. The full set is the version most of our customers end up living in. If you go head-to-toe cream, break it with the navy cap or a black tote so the outfit has an anchor.

Colour pairings that always work

  • Cream + navy: the house pairing. Crisp, calm, never wrong.
  • Cream + camel: warm and expensive-looking, great for autumn.
  • Navy + sand: the reverse of the above; grounds a lighter bottom half.
  • Black + cream: highest contrast, best when the print is small.
